Description
The angular distributions of the fission fragments of a gold target have been measured in peripheral collisions initiated by several beams: Ar, Kr, Xe, Pb at energies ranging from 27 to 60 MeV/u. The angular momentum transfers in the various reactions have been deduced from these angular distributions and compared with theoretical predictions. The possibility to obtain the angular momentum transfer from the measured angular distribution of the light charged particles is also discussed. (orig.)
